804 ; The version of the C++ ABI in use. The following values are allowed:
805 ;
806 ; 0: The version of the ABI believed most conformant with the C++ ABI
807 ; specification. This ABI may change as bugs are discovered and fixed.
808 ; Therefore, 0 will not necessarily indicate the same ABI in different
809 ; versions of G++.
810 ;
811 ; 1: The version of the ABI first used in G++ 3.2. No longer selectable.
812 ;
813 ; 2: The version of the ABI first used in G++ 3.4, and the default
814 ; until GCC 4.9.
815 ;
816 ; 3: The version of the ABI that fixes the missing underscore
817 ; in template non-type arguments of pointer type.
818 ;
819 ; 4: The version of the ABI that introduces unambiguous mangling of
820 ; vector types. First selectable in G++ 4.5.
821 ;
822 ; 5: The version of the ABI that ignores attribute const/noreturn
823 ; in function pointer mangling, and corrects mangling of decltype and
824 ; function parameters used in other parameters and the return type.
825 ; First selectable in G++ 4.6.
826 ;
827 ; 6: The version of the ABI that doesn't promote scoped enums to int and
828 ; changes the mangling of template argument packs, const/static_cast,
829 ; prefix ++ and --, and a class scope function used as a template
830 ; argument.
831 ; First selectable in G++ 4.7.
832 ;
833 ; 7: The version of the ABI that treats nullptr_t as a builtin type and
834 ; corrects the mangling of lambdas in default argument scope.
835 ; First selectable in G++ 4.8.
836 ;
837 ; 8: The version of the ABI that corrects the substitution behavior of
838 ; function types with function-cv-qualifiers.
839 ; First selectable in G++ 4.9 and default in G++ 5.
840 ;
841 ; 9: The version of the ABI that corrects the alignment of nullptr_t.
842 ; First selectable and default in G++ 5.2.
843 ;
844 ; 10: The version of the ABI that mangles attributes that affect type
845 ; identity, such as ia32 calling convention attributes (stdcall, etc.)
846 ; Default in G++ 6 (set in c_common_post_options).
847 ;
848 ; Additional positive integers will be assigned as new versions of
849 ; the ABI become the default version of the ABI.
850 fabi-version=
851 Common Joined RejectNegative UInteger Var(flag_abi_version) Init(0)
852 The version of the C++ ABI in use
